Ведущий C++ разработчик (под Windows/Linux)

Positive Technologies

Ведущий C++ разработчик (под Windows/Linux)

Описание вакансии

Кто мы

Positive Technologies — вендор продуктов и услуг в области кибербезопасности. Более 20 лет наша основная задача — предотвращать хакерские атаки до того, как они причинят неприемлемый ущерб бизнесу и целым отраслям экономики. Наши технологии используют около 4000 организаций по всему миру.

О команде

Мы - команда увлечённых энтузиастов, разрабатывающих сердце любого антивирусного решения от консьюмерских до больших корпоративных - антивирусный движок. Мы придумываем новые алгоритмы быстрого анализа потока данных, приходящих на движок. Занимаемся разработкой высокооптимизированного кода, используя самые передовые возможности языка C++ 20-ой версии и выше. Исследуем каверзные и замысловатые ситуации в логике анализа и исполнения кода. Развиваем технологии эмуляции и многоуровневой распаковки подозрительных объектов.

Мы ищем С++ разработчика, которому интересно

  • Изучать сложную архитектуру, открывая для себя технические подходы, доказавшие свою эффективность на практике
  • Строить архитектурные решения, удовлетворяющие внешним критериям качества антивирусного движка;
  • Погружаться на самый низкий уровень мира байтов - раскрывать новые форматы файлов, писать эффективный код для их парсинга и обработки;
  • Развивать технологии эмуляции как на уровне процессора, так и на уровне интерпретируемых скриптов.

Мы ждем, что у тебя есть

  • Коммерческий опыт разработки на С++ больше 5-ти лет;
  • Навыки написания приложений на C/C++ под Windows или Linux без использования высокоуровневых фреймворков;
  • Понимание работы ОС с точки зрения взаимодействия с user-space приложениями (работа с памятью, файлами, как ОС запускает программы);
  • Опыт написания многопоточных приложений, использующих базовые примитивы синхронизации типа mutex / critical section;
  • Навык в управлении исходным кодом на git (бранчевание, патчи, мержи), сборка проектов на cmake/make, дружба с компиляторами gcc/clang/msvc.

Будет плюсом

  • Погружение в ОС до уровня kernel-side кода (драйвера, модули ядра);
  • Опыт с языком x86-64 ассебмлера.

Что мы предлагаем

  • Гибкий подход к отдыху: 28 календарных дней отпуска, доплату отпускных до полного оклада и 10 day off в год
  • Возможность работы как удаленно, так и в одном из офисов РФ
  • Заботу о здоровье: ДМС с первой недели работы, включая стоматологию, ежегодный чекап
  • Компенсацию до 50% расходов на занятия спортом и английским языком в рамках ежегодного бюджета
  • Работу в аккредитованной ИТ-компании и возможность использования льгот Министерства цифрового развития
  • Условия для постоянного развития: внешние и внутренние образовательные программы, митапы, научпоп-лекции, экспертное обучение и не только
Навыки
  • C++
  • x86-64
  • Windows
  • Linux
Посмотреть контакты работодателя

Похожие вакансии

РДП Энтерпрайз
  • Москва

  • Не указана

Рекомендуем
Группа компаний Астра

C++ разработчик (RuBackup)

Группа компаний Астра

  • Москва

  • Не указана

Рекомендуем
Группа компаний Астра
  • Москва

  • Не указана

Рекомендуем
Positive Technologies
  • Москва

  • Не указана

  • Москва

  • Не указана

DIS Group
  • Москва

  • Не указана

Лаборатория Касперского

Разработчик C++ (KasperskyOS, Mobile SDK)

Лаборатория Касперского

  • Москва

  • Не указана

Реверслаб
  • Москва

  • от 250000 RUR

  • Москва

  • от 250000 RUR

2ГИС
  • Москва

  • от 250000 RUR

Сбербанк-Сервис
  • Москва

  • от 250000 RUR

Системы Коммуникаций
  • Москва

  • от 250000 RUR

SkillStaff
  • Москва

  • от 250000 RUR

КСОР
  • Москва

  • от 250000 RUR

Go Invest
  • Москва

  • от 250000 RUR

Мфп Технологии

Ведущий разработчик С++

Мфп Технологии

  • Москва

  • до 250000 RUR

  • Москва

  • от 400000 RUR

BLACKHUB GAMES

C++ UI developer (mobile)

BLACKHUB GAMES

  • Москва

  • от 400000 RUR

КАТЮША ПРИНТ
  • Москва

  • от 180000 RUR

Хотите оставить вакансию?

Заполните форму и найдите сотрудника всего за несколько минут.
Оставить вакансию